A documentary about the work of Luke Kelly, legendary folk singer with the Dubliners, who died in 1984. Kelly's influence on balladeers has been wide-reaching. Here, his famous contemporaries - like Donovan and Ralph McTell - discuss his art, and the key moments of his development in music. Includes 19 rarely seen live performances, and further contributions by the Dubliners, Damien Dempsey, Paddy Reilly, Jim McCann, Mary Black, Phil Coulter and George Murphy.

Plot Summary

This documentary delves into the life and career of Luke Kelly, the legendary Irish folk singer and frontman of The Dubliners. It explores his powerful performances, his unwavering commitment to social justice, and his enduring legacy in Irish music. Through archival footage and interviews with those who knew him, the film celebrates his unique talent and profound impact.
